There are 2 General Contractors in Odin, Illinois, serving a population of 1,096 people in an area of 2 square miles. There is 1 General Contractor per 548 people, and 1 General Contractor per square mile.
In Illinois, Odin is ranked 1,095th of 1547 cities in General Contractors per capita, and 1,179th of 1547 cities in General Contractors per square mile.
Find addresses, phone numbers, fax numbers, hours & services for Odin General Contractors.
Cyber Health Information Connection 205 Perkins Street Odin, IL
Potter Construction 1503 Community Beach Road Odin, IL